Door Handle Refurbishment: Bringing Life Back to Your Hardware


Door handles might look like little, unnoticeable elements of a home, however they play an essential role in both looks and functionality. Over time, door handles can end up being used, damaged, or harmed, leading homeowners to consider replacement. Nevertheless, before hurrying to buy new hardware, one may wish to check out door handle refurbishment as a cost-effective and eco-friendly option. This post explores the benefits, procedures, and typical questions surrounding door handle refurbishment.

What is Door Handle Refurbishment?


Door handle refurbishment is the procedure of restoring and renewing existing door handles instead of changing them. rep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k can involve cleansing, polishing, fixing, or totally re-coating the handles to return them to their initial shine and function. It's typically a sustainable option, decreasing the waste associated with disposing of damaged or dated hardware.

Benefits of Door Handle Refurbishment


  1. Cost-efficient: Refurbishing door handles is generally less expensive than acquiring new ones. Depending on the level of refurbishment needed, it can save property owners a significant quantity of cash.

  2. Sustainability: By reconditioning rather than changing, house owners can contribute to reducing waste and saving resources. This environment-friendly option is becoming progressively popular among environmentally mindful customers.

  3. Conservation of Character: Older homes typically have distinct or antique door handles that add to their appeal. Refurbishing enables homeowners to preserve the aesthetic stability of their property.

  4. Personalization Options: During refurbishment, house owners can select to change the surface or appearance of their handles, supplying a chance for modification without the cost of new hardware.

  5. Enhanced Functionality: Sometimes, handles may be stuck or difficult to run. Refurbishment can restore smooth movement, improving user experience.

The Refurbishment Process


The refurbishment procedure can differ depending upon the type and condition of the door handles. Here's a basic introduction:

Step 1: Assessment

Examine the condition of the door handles. Search for signs of wear, rust, or damage. This action will assist figure out the required refurbishment methods.

Step 2: Cleaning

Eliminate any dirt, grime, or old lube. A service of warm soapy water can be utilized for most handles. For stained metal, a specialized cleaner or a mixture of vinegar and baking soda can be reliable.

Action 3: Repair

Resolve any mechanical concerns. This might include tightening screws, replacing springs, or fixing any broken parts. For more severe damage, it might be required to source replacement parts.

Step 4: Polishing

Polish the handles utilizing a soft fabric and a proper metal polish. This action restores shine and boosts the appearance of the handles.

Step 5: Re-coating (if necessary)

If the handles are significantly stained or scratched, a brand-new surface may be needed. This can include spray painting, powder coating, or applying a new layer of lacquer, depending upon the product.

Step 6: Reinstallation

Once reconditioned, thoroughly reattach the handles to the doors. Guarantee that all screws are tightened up appropriately to maintain performance.

Table 2: Common Materials for Door Handles and Refurbishment Tips

Material

Refurbishment Tips

Brass

Use polishing substance; prevent abrasive cleaners

Stainless-steel

Use soft cloth and stainless steel cleaner; prevent scratches

Wood

Sand lightly and use wood polish or varnish

Plastic

Tidy with mild soap; avoid harsh chemicals

Aluminum

Use a mild polish; consider anodizing for security

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)


Q1: How frequently should I refurbish my door handles?

A1: The frequency of refurbishment can vary based upon usage and the environment. Generally, it's advisable to evaluate door handles each year.

Q2: Can I refurbish door handles myself?

A2: Yes, lots of door handles can be refurbished by house owners with some standard tools and materials. However, if handles are significantly harmed or if you're unsure, it might be best to seek advice from a professional.

Q3: Will refurbishment alter the functionality of my door handles?

A3: Proper refurbishment needs to bring back, if not improve, the initial functionality of the door handles. However, be sure to properly examine and repair any mechanical problems during the procedure.

Q4: Is it possible to change the surface of my door handles during refurbishment?

A4: Yes, refurbishment provides an outstanding opportunity to change the surface of door handles. Options include painting, polishing, or using a brand-new finish.

Q5: What tools do I require for door handle refurbishment?

A5: Basic tools such as screwdrivers, soft cloths, cleaning services, polish, and perhaps some sandpaper or paint may be needed, depending on the refurbishment procedure you choose.
